Bluetooth 5.2 – Seamless Wireless Streaming with High Fidelity
Unlike older MP3 players, the Surfans F20 HiFi MP3 Player features Bluetooth 5.2, offering faster pairing, extended range, and greater stability for wireless headphones or speakers.
Most importantly for audiophiles, this device supports aptX HD codec, ensuring high-quality audio transmission over Bluetooth — a major upgrade from basic SBC compression.
That means you get near-lossless sound wirelessly, perfect for:
- High-end Bluetooth headphones
- Car stereo streaming
- Wireless home speaker setups
- Gym or travel use without cables
It also works in both transmitter and receiver mode, allowing you to either stream music from the player to Bluetooth devices or receive music from your phone — an extremely versatile option.

DSD, FLAC, APE and More – True Lossless Format Support
The defining feature of the Surfans F20 HiFi MP3 Player is its commitment to lossless audio. It supports all major high-resolution file formats, including:
- DSD64/128
- FLAC
- APE
- WAV
- ALAC
- AIFF
It also plays standard MP3, WMA, and AAC files for convenience.
If you’re the type of listener who collects studio masters or vinyl rips in DSD format, this player will handle them effortlessly, thanks to its dedicated DAC (Digital-to-Analog Converter) and TI Burr-Brown PCM5102 chip — a name well-known among serious audio engineers.
This chip ensures high signal-to-noise ratio, low distortion, and warm, balanced sound across frequencies.

High-Resolution Output with Line Out Mode
Beyond headphones and Bluetooth, the Surfans F20 HiFi MP3 Player also features a dedicated line-out port, which allows you to connect it to an external amplifier, DAC, or stereo receiver.
This bypasses internal amplification and gives you pure signal output — ideal for audiophiles building a custom listening chain.
Pair it with a tube amp, bookshelf speakers, or even your car’s aux input, and experience your music in uncompromised clarity.
Battery Life Built for Marathon Listening
The built-in 1500mAh rechargeable battery delivers up to 10–12 hours of continuous playback, depending on file type and Bluetooth usage. Charging is handled via micro USB, and a full charge takes approximately 2–3 hours.
While not the longest battery life on the market, it’s more than enough for daily use, commutes, or long flights. And because it’s an offline player, you’re not draining your phone battery to enjoy music.

Ease of Use and File Transfer
Transferring music to the Surfans F20 HiFi MP3 Player is simple. It connects to your computer via USB and mounts like a standard drive — just drag and drop your files. No proprietary software required.
You can organize tracks manually or with folder-syncing apps. It supports:
- File browsing by artist, album, genre
- Manual or automatic playlists
- Repeat, shuffle, and gapless playback
The UI is clean, responsive, and refreshingly simple compared to over-complicated streaming apps.
